🛠 The Toolkit
To make this work, we use a powerful combination of Google’s ecosystem:
- Google Gemini: The core engine that handles our complex queries and data analysis.
- Gems (Custom Personalities): Where we build the "tutor" persona, setting rules for how the AI should teach, quiz, and support.
- NotebookLM: A specialised environment where the AI is "grounded" strictly in the documents we provide, ensuring 100% relevance to our notes.
📋 The 4-Phase Process
In the attached document and video, I walk you through the four essential phases of setting this up:
- Phase 1: Knowledge Curation – Identifying your "Primary Truth" (PDFs, notes, or datasets).
- Phase 2: Persona Setup – Using Gems to define the tutor’s role and operational constraints.
- Phase 3: The Pedagogical Layer – Implementing Socratic guardrails so the AI guides you rather than just giving answers.
- Phase 4: Deployment – Linking everything into a seamless study interface.
